The Significance of Swift Action in Water Damages Reconstruction



When you face water damages, acting swiftly can make all the difference. The longer you wait, the much more substantial the damages ends up being. Water can leak into walls, flooring, and individual belongings, leading to mold and mildew development and structural problems. By taking immediate activity, you can lessen the damages and conserve your property from more deterioration.


You must first evaluate the situation and determine the source of the water. If it's secure, turned off the water to avoid extra flooding. Next, begin eliminating standing water using containers or a wet/dry vacuum cleaner. Dry out impacted locations with followers and dehumidifiers to lower moisture degrees.


Do not wait to call professionals for aid if the damage seems overwhelming. They have the tools and know-how to handle water repair effectively. Bear in mind, speedy activity is crucial; it not only safeguards your property yet also saves you time, money, and stress over time.

Water Damage Control



Water damage can strike unexpectedly, leaving you with a challenging job in advance. The initial step in tackling this problem is conducting a complete water damage assessment. You'll require to determine the resource of the water, whether it's from a ruptured pipe, flooding, or a device malfunction. Next off, examine the affected areas for visible signs of damages, such as discoloration, swelling, or mold and mildew development. It's essential to evaluate the degree of the damages, as this will certainly determine the repair process. Use moisture meters to determine surprise wetness in wall surfaces and floors. Document your searchings for with images and notes for insurance purposes. By comprehending the severity of the damages, you can make educated decisions progressing in your reconstruction trip.

Advanced Technologies in Water Removal and Drying



While taking care of water damage can be frustrating, advanced technologies in removal and drying out make the process a lot more effective. You'll find that customized tools like high-powered pumps and industrial vacuum cleaners can promptly get rid of standing water, reducing the threat of more damages. These equipments not just extract water but additionally enhance the drying procedure.


Following, you'll discover the usage of dehumidifiers and air movers. These gadgets interact to lower moisture degrees and flow air, accelerating dissipation. water damage cleanup. By strategically placing them, you can guarantee that every damaged area dries thoroughly


Thermal imaging electronic cameras additionally play a crucial duty, as they aid you recognize covert moisture pockets that traditional methods might miss out on. This means, you can resolve all damp areas, avoiding future difficulties. With these advanced devices, your water reconstruction efforts come to be a lot more efficient, permitting you to go back to typical life faster.


Preventing Mold And Mildew Growth After Water Damages



To effectively prevent mold growth after water damages, it's crucial to act swiftly and decisively. Start by eliminating any standing water right away, as mold and mildew grows in damp settings.


Following, tidy and disinfect surface areas with a mix of water and cleaning agent, and take into consideration utilizing a mold-inhibiting remedy for extra protection. Pay unique focus to concealed areas like behind walls and beneath floor covering, where wetness can remain unnoticed.


Ultimately, check the location very closely for any type of indications of mold and mildew. If you find any type of, address it without delay to avoid further spread. By taking these proactive actions, you can significantly decrease the risk of mold and mildew development, making certain a healthier atmosphere in the consequences of water damages.

Insurance Coverage Considerations for Water Damage Repair



Steering the complexities of insurance coverage for water damages reconstruction can feel overwhelming, specifically when you're facing the consequences of a catastrophe. To start, examine your policy to comprehend what's covered. emergency water damage restoration. The majority of property owners' insurance coverage cover abrupt and unintentional water damages, like ruptured pipes, yet may exclude flooding damage


Following, record the damage extensively. Take images and maintain invoices for any repair work or short-lived repairs. This documentation can be essential when filing a case. Contact your insurance provider asap to report the incident, and inquire about the insurance claims process.


Don't wait to look for assistance from your repair solution; they frequently have experience handling insurer and can guide you via the claim procedure. water damage repair services. Be prepared for potential disputes over protection. Knowing your policy in and out can aid you support efficiently for the repair solutions you require

Frequently Asked Questions



Just How Can I Determine Hidden Water Damage in My Home?



To recognize concealed water damages, look for water stains, mold development, or distorted walls. Use a dampness meter in questionable areas, and examine your pipes for leakages. Trust your impulses-- if something appears off, explore better.


What Are the Signs of a Mold Issue After Water Damages?



After water damage, you'll discover mildewy smells, visible mold development, and boosted moisture. Look for dark places on wall surfaces or ceilings, and keep an eye out for peeling paint or deformed surfaces. Do not overlook these indications!


Exactly how Lengthy Does the Water Restoration Process Usually Take?



The water reconstruction procedure usually takes an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ks. It relies on the level of the damage, the materials entailed, and how swiftly you resolve the problem.


Exist Any Health Dangers Surrounding Water Damages?



Yes, there are wellness threats related to water damage. Mold and mildew growth, microorganisms, and structural problems can cause breathing problems, allergies, and other health problems. It's vital to attend to water damages immediately to reduce these risks.


What Should I Do Before Specialists Show Up for Reconstruction?





Prior to experts arrive, you need to transform off the power, eliminate belongings from the location, and start drying out surface areas with towels. If secure, open windows for ventilation to help stop further damage and mold growth.
